3. Disability Identity Lens Application Examine your research findings through six disability identity themes:

  • Communal Attachment: How do practices support connections with peers and community?
  • Affirmation of Disability: Do approaches promote full citizenship and inclusion?
  • Self-Worth: How do strategies affirm student value and capability?
  • Pride: Do methods encourage students to embrace their identity?
  • Discrimination Awareness: How do researchers address bias and systemic barriers?
  • Personal Meaning: Do approaches help students find purpose in their experiences?

Research Strategy Guidelines

Database Recommendations: Begin your search using education databases such as ERIC, PsycINFO, or Education Source. Look for recent meta-analyses or systematic reviews that provide comprehensive overviews of your topic.

Source Evaluation: Ensure sources represent peer-reviewed research from recognized professional organizations. Exclude popular magazines, non-peer-reviewed websites, undergraduate papers, and opinion pieces without research foundations.

Writing Approach: Focus on letting the research findings guide your synthesis. Look for patterns, contradictions, and gaps in the literature while using transition sentences to demonstrate relationships between studies. Maintain a scholarly tone throughout and reserve personal opinions for brief introduction or conclusion sections only.
